Carcanets were typically quite elaborate and formal, worn closely fitted to the neck. The style seems to have first appeared with the re-emergence of the necklace during the end of the medieval period in the late 1300s.

In the early days of gold working, jewelry would have been produced from gold as it was found. Nuggets would be hammered into sheets on which simple techniques like chasing and repoussé would be applied. Sheets could be cut into shapes and rolled into tubes. The wires could be plain or decoratively twisted. Historically, filigree was created by applying the wires to an underlying base. The earliest known pomanders were reportedly from the East and reserved for the use of nobility and clergy. By the 14th century, the name pomander had evolved to also refer to the container, which became increasingly more decorative and symbolic. Retro Jewelry. The International Exhibition of Arts and Techniques in Modern Life – 1937, Paris - signaled an end to the Art Deco Era. Jewelry exhibitors at this exhibition favored flowers, animals, and scrolls which were the antithesis of the prior geometric period. Suzanne Belperron was born Madeleine Suzanne Vuillerme on September 26, 1900, to Jules Alix Vuillerme and Marie Clarisse Baily-Maitre in Saint-Claude, France. Lalaounis. Lalaounis Lion's Head Cufflinks. Ilias Lalaounis is an Athenian jewelry company known for its antiquity-inspired designs. In 1940, at age twenty, founder Ilias Lalaounis began his career by apprenticing at the prestigious Zolotas — the family business. Eventually, Lalaounis started his own firm, specializing in fabricating chains.

Etruscan jewelry can be roughly divided into two periods: Early Etruscan and Late Etruscan. From the 7th century BC until the 5th the civilisation came to its full glory. A sharp-edged die is placed on the metal and hammered until it cuts through the underlying metal. These dies sometimes have a design on them that is embossed into the metal shape that is being cut. This Skønvirke movement in Denmark encompassed the years 1900 to 1925, roughly the period when Arts & Crafts and Art Nouveau were popular in Europe. Edwardian Diamond and Natural Pearl Sautoir. A sautoir is a French term for a long necklace that suspends a tassel or other ornament. Necklaces that would fit the criteria for a sautoir have existed throughout history.
